I'm a total novice, trying to help a young friend in the Grenadines deal with a problem concerning his 1990 Johnson 225. We can only talk on the phone, and I know precious little about boats. He's asking me to procure for him a "steering tube" which he describes as a hollow metal tube, about 15 inches long, give or take, threaded on both ends, that is hollow. Can someone help me understand what this part is, and how I can get a new one for him? Please forgive my lack of knowledge. Just trying to help someone in a difficult situation. Thanks very much.

if your friend has internet connection, tell him to go to brp evinrude.com, clik literature, engine diagrams, then his year and model, then mid section, there is a full blow up of the parts diagram, and parts numbers. the tilt tube, which i assume he's calling a steering tube, because the steering cable goes thru it. the part # is 0335553 for the tilt tube, doe she need nuts, washers, bushing?

The tube is usually built into motors made it the 90's. It is a tube that the motor pivots on when it is tilted up. The tube holds the motor end of the steering cable.

This picture is for mounting a steering tube for motors that don't have one built in. In this picture, it is the pipe looking piece. These pieces you can order from iboats.

40272.gif


Ask you friend if the tube is part of the motor or separate, as in the photo above. If it is part of the motor, go to a Johnson dealer with his model number and the dealer will be able to order the replacement parts.

Sometimes ebay has motors for parts. I don't believe you will be able to order that engine part new from anywhere but a dealer.
